Now that the photo-shoot is complete, Jay and I insist on heading over to Tower of Terror. Jon hasn't been on this ride since 2002 and it's changed a lot since then - seatbelts instead of safety bars and multiple drops - and in our opinion it's much more fun.

Grimace doesn't ride anything remotely scary so she went shopping while we were getting our adrenaline rush. One of the reasons Jay and I love visiting WDW in October is that even at 11AM in the morning we can enter the stand-by line for ToT and only have a 10-minute wait. Life is good!

Absolutely Impeared Martini

3 ounces Absolut Pear Vodka
3/4 ounce DeKuyper Melon Liqueur
3 ounces pineapple juice
1 thin slice green Anjou pear (are Anjou pears any color other than green?)

Fill cocktail shaker halfway with ice. Add vodka & melon liqueur. Next add pineapple juice. Shake vigorously until mixture becomes cloudy (or until you just feel like stopping - we don't have x-ray vision and can't see through our stainless steel shaker). Strain into a sugar-rimmed martini glass and garnish with a slice of pear.
